guster concert: B

By ibzp on 07.21.07 | 2 Comments

Well, last night’s Guster concert at the State Theater Fillmore Detroit was a lot of fun, but the castoffs from “So You Think You Can Dance” who were flailing about in front of us put a bit of a damper on the show. These kids had apparently just graduated from the Elaine Benes school of dance.

Anyway, I thought the setlist was great, but Stef and I agreed that there were a few glaring omissions; Fa Fa and Two Points for Honesty being the ones I missed the most.

Overall the band sounded great. If anything, I thoght they played better than they did at MSU when we saw them last year — the guys really tore it up on a few songs.

Of course, this was part of the problem. I don’t know if it’s just the acoustics in that arena, or if they had the speakers cranked louder than normal, but there were a few songs towards the end of the night that surpassed the pain threshhold for me. My ears are still ringing nearly twelve hours later.

So, on the whole, it was a really fun evening, but a few annoyances brought the show down a notch or two in my book.

Setlist: B+
The Band: A
Crowd: C-
Physical Pain from standing + volume: D+
Overall: B
